The STK672-732B-E is a unipolar stepper motor driver IC designed for general-purpose applications. Manufactured by onsemi, this device is part of the Power Management (PMIC) category and is housed in a 19SIP package. It features a half-bridge output configuration capable of delivering up to 2.2A of current, making it suitable for driving stepper motors efficiently. The IC operates within a supply voltage range of 4.75V to 5.25V and can handle load voltages from 0V to 46V. The STK672-732B-E supports step resolutions of 1 and 1/2, providing flexibility in motor control applications. It is mounted through-hole and is REACH unaffected, ensuring compliance with environmental regulations. The device is packaged in a tube and has a moisture sensitivity level (MSL) of 1, indicating unlimited storage conditions.
